Position Summary
The Import Manager directs and manages the activities of the import department within a branch, ensuring all import activities—both transportation and customs brokerage—are in compliance with regulatory requirements.
Responsibilities
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Establish, oversee, and continuously improve import process flows in conformance with applicable rules, procedures, and company policy.
- Develop internal SOPs and maintain KPIs for efficient management of inbound freight, including timely recovery and handover to brokers.
- Collaborate with sales to create customer-specific import handling procedures, especially during new customer onboarding.
- Ensure accurate documentation is created and transmitted to government agencies. Provide timely responses to customs, customer, and internal inquiries regarding classification, duty rates, documentation, and other import regulations.
- Represent customers to CBP as needed.
- Maintain current knowledge of CBP and other agency regulations, incorporating changes into departmental processes and ensuring employees receive proper compliance training.
- Organize, update, and disseminate client data (rate agreements, HTS classification, POA, IRS, Customs Bond data, etc.) for proper system updates.
- Review and enhance account profitability, billing accuracy, and timeliness.
- Arrange transportation, warehousing, or distribution of imported products, balancing transit times and profit opportunities. Negotiate contracts/rates with delivery agents.
- Prepare monthly reports for management.
- Train and onboard new staff.
- Conduct entry audits.
- Support accounts receivable collections when needed.
Customs Brokerage Responsibilities
In certain branches, the Import Manager oversees customs brokerage activities and functions as the broker of record. Responsibilities include:
- Serving as the licensed broker responsible to US Customs.
- Interfacing with government agencies and maintaining positive relationships.
- Maintaining customer bond and power of attorney files.
- Performing post-entry functions such as tariff concessions, refunds, duty drawbacks, credits, and issue resolution.
- Managing the audit program to ensure continual compliance.
- Conducting audits and assessing import compliance on all customs brokerage files.
- Ensuring JSOX compliance.
